thereabouts

 

Definitions from WordNet

Adverbial thereabouts has 2 senses
  1. thereabout, thereabouts - near that time or date; "come at noon or thereabouts"
  2. thereabout, thereabouts - near that place; "he stayed in London or thereabouts for several weeks"
